I just bought an S40 T5 and love it! I've heard adding a sway bar can drastically improve the ride quality of volvos(not that I have any complaints). I've done some looking around and it seems that most aftermarket parts companies sell rear sway bars instead of front. Why is this? Is there a big difference in the ride when a rear sway bar is installed vs a front sway bar?

The front would be a major undertaking and really is not necessary. Changing the rear does really make a difference. For the front, strut upgrades work well.
